Transaction 598835a21fbd334eba8897fff8b3f7209dae5e58a270fa1b6a03ee7bd78f30a6

2 Input
2 Outputs
  • 598835a21fbd334eba8897fff8b3f7209dae5e58a270fa1b6a03ee7bd78f30a6:0
  • value  138750
    address  1EXH3tuGYHkzcKe7B628mQDx4o12zWKBEz
  • 598835a21fbd334eba8897fff8b3f7209dae5e58a270fa1b6a03ee7bd78f30a6:1
  • value  880500
    address  3H8fNAU2VCpkP83tSwd4ozAmxFjRVCHWGA